Merritt, Blumenherst win '10 qualifiers

Troy Merritt has never played in a PGA Tour event. That's about to change. Merritt shot a 3-under-par 69 to win the PGA Tour qualifying tournament in West Palm Beach, Fla., finishing the six-round event at 22 under and one shot ahead of tour veteran Jeff Maggert .

Hamilton to play fulltime on European Tour in 2010

Former British Open champion Todd Hamilton will play fulltime on the European Tour next season.

New leader tapped by the LPGA

The LPGA Tour picked Michael Whan as its new commissioner, turning to a former marketing executive in golf and hockey equipment to rebuild the tour's relationships with sponsors.
